互联网行业更新迭代的速度令人咋舌,去年还是“互联网+”,现在“区块链+”就已经占据主导地位。如今各个行业都在探索区块链应用落地的场景。
区块链经历了比特币 1.0 时代,以太坊 2.0 时代,以及目前正在进行的 3.0时代,应用领域正在蔓延到各行各业,主要底层技术包含:密码学、共识算法、分布式存储、P2P 网络系统。
区块链系统开发特点
一、去中心化
每个人都是我们团体当中的一个节点,每个人现在做的事情都是一个数据,把它存储起来就是将来举证的一个证据。咱们现实社会当中有哪些中心?包括公证处,包括现在一些中介机构,去中心化就意味着将来这些机构都会消失,这些角色都会不存在,这个对我们将来影响非常大。
二、无需建立信任关系,不可篡改和信息防伪。
例如现在大家讲的数字产权保护,像是之前《一出好戏》维权等,还有20多年前一位作家投出去的稿子对方告诉他没有录入,但他很快发现在不同的期刊上换了名称,换了作家刊登出来。这个时候他明显知道侵权了,怎么办?没有办法取证。当时他采用了非常笨的方法,他给编辑部寄文章的时候同时回寄给自己一份,如果再出现这个问题的时候,他就把当时寄给自己的那一份拿到法庭上去,这个邮件不能拆封,上面的日期就等同于区块链的时间戳,这个证据是有效的。有了区块链系统之后,现在你只要把它放到链上就好了。
三、集体维护
区块链是分布式的帐本,每个人都会维护它,这能很好解决关键数据保护和授权访问问题。现在解决不了信息资源的开放共享,因为互联网设计理念是以IP地址和机器来做的,有了区块链系统之后这个问题变得迎刃而解。因为区块链系统的设计理念是以对象为核心,以数据为对象。
四、可靠数据库
区块链和电子认证的底层的技术是完全一样的,就是PKI加上HASH,就如参加大会佩戴的胸牌,胸牌是拿身份证在登记处领取的,它解决了几个问题,一是去个性化的,这就既包含了个人隐私,又保证了信息可追溯。HASH算法也是解决这个问题,不管你的文件是什么,算法上就一个输入和输出,每个文件只能输出这样一个唯一的字节,和胸牌差不多。但是能还原、对应到原来的文件是谁。
其实,比特币至今都存在很大争议,,但是从纯技术角度去看,比特币是目前来说最成功的区块链应用,而其中最核心的就是它的底层交易系统,把支撑比特币的底层交易系统原理弄清楚,是成为区块链开发者最重要的一环。而区块链技术就是解决了现在数据资源的开放和共享的问题,一个是个人隐私保护,另一个是是没有得到授权下的访问。
无论怎样,区块链技术时代已经到来,你现在要做的就是接受到,并且运用它!
网友评论